"Welcome to the World" is a song by Australian rock-pop band Noiseworks. It was released in November 1987 as the fourth single from their first studio album Noiseworks (1987) and peaked at number 41 on the Australian singles chart in January 1988. It was also released as a CD single, which was rather unique for an Australian band at the time.[3]
